It's almost always the column switch. It's a 50/50 chance one can remove the column switch and clean all contacts to get it working properly. I have found though over time it's easier just to replace the switch assembly with a known good used unit.

Of course it's easier to replace the relay, and I always have a spare relay to check it out, but 90% of the time it always leads back to the column switch assembly.
